implservice

package
v1.0.55 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 18, 2024 License: MIT Imports: 7 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type GroupServiceImpl added in v1.0.46

type GroupServiceImpl struct {
	GroupDao       rbacdb.GroupDAO       //starter:inject("#")
	GroupConvertor rbacdb.GroupConvertor //starter:inject("#")
	// contains filtered or unexported fields
}

GroupServiceImpl ...

func (*GroupServiceImpl) Delete added in v1.0.46

func (inst *GroupServiceImpl) Delete(c context.Context, id rbac.GroupID) error

Delete ...

func (*GroupServiceImpl) Find added in v1.0.46

Find ...

func (*GroupServiceImpl) Insert added in v1.0.46

func (inst *GroupServiceImpl) Insert(c context.Context, o *rbac.GroupDTO) (*rbac.GroupDTO, error)

Insert ...

func (*GroupServiceImpl) List added in v1.0.46

List ...

func (*GroupServiceImpl) Update added in v1.0.46

Update ...

type PermissionCacheImpl

type PermissionCacheImpl struct {
	PermissionService rbac.PermissionService //starter:inject("#")
	// contains filtered or unexported fields
}

PermissionCacheImpl ...

func (*PermissionCacheImpl) Clear

func (inst *PermissionCacheImpl) Clear()

Clear ...

func (*PermissionCacheImpl) Find

Find ...

type PermissionServiceImpl

type PermissionServiceImpl struct {
	PermissionDao       rbacdb.PermissionDAO       //starter:inject("#")
	PermissionConvertor rbacdb.PermissionConvertor //starter:inject("#")
	PermissionCache     rbac.PermissionCache       //starter:inject("#")
	// contains filtered or unexported fields
}

PermissionServiceImpl ...

func (*PermissionServiceImpl) Delete

Delete ...

func (*PermissionServiceImpl) Find

Find ...

func (*PermissionServiceImpl) GetCache

func (inst *PermissionServiceImpl) GetCache() rbac.PermissionCache

GetCache ...

func (*PermissionServiceImpl) Insert

Insert ...

func (*PermissionServiceImpl) List

List ...

func (*PermissionServiceImpl) ListAll

ListAll ...

func (*PermissionServiceImpl) Update

Update ...

type RegionServiceImpl added in v0.0.7

type RegionServiceImpl struct {
	RegionDao       rbacdb.RegionDAO       //starter:inject("#")
	RegionConvertor rbacdb.RegionConvertor //starter:inject("#")
	// contains filtered or unexported fields
}

RegionServiceImpl ...

func (*RegionServiceImpl) Delete added in v0.0.7

func (inst *RegionServiceImpl) Delete(c context.Context, id rbac.RegionID) error

Delete ...

func (*RegionServiceImpl) Find added in v0.0.7

Find ...

func (*RegionServiceImpl) Insert added in v0.0.7

Insert ...

func (*RegionServiceImpl) List added in v0.0.7

List ...

func (*RegionServiceImpl) Update added in v0.0.7

Update ...

type RoleServiceImpl

type RoleServiceImpl struct {
	RoleDao       rbacdb.RoleDAO       //starter:inject("#")
	RoleConvertor rbacdb.RoleConvertor //starter:inject("#")
	// contains filtered or unexported fields
}

RoleServiceImpl ...

func (*RoleServiceImpl) Delete

func (inst *RoleServiceImpl) Delete(c context.Context, id rbac.RoleID) error

Delete ...

func (*RoleServiceImpl) Find

func (inst *RoleServiceImpl) Find(c context.Context, id rbac.RoleID) (*rbac.RoleDTO, error)

Find ...

func (*RoleServiceImpl) Insert

func (inst *RoleServiceImpl) Insert(c context.Context, o *rbac.RoleDTO) (*rbac.RoleDTO, error)

Insert ...

func (*RoleServiceImpl) List

func (inst *RoleServiceImpl) List(c context.Context, q *rbac.RoleQuery) ([]*rbac.RoleDTO, error)

List ...

func (*RoleServiceImpl) Update

func (inst *RoleServiceImpl) Update(c context.Context, id rbac.RoleID, o *rbac.RoleDTO) (*rbac.RoleDTO, error)

Update ...

type UserServiceImpl

type UserServiceImpl struct {
	UserDao       rbacdb.UserDAO       //starter:inject("#")
	UserConvertor rbacdb.UserConvertor //starter:inject("#")
	// contains filtered or unexported fields
}

UserServiceImpl ...

func (*UserServiceImpl) Delete

func (inst *UserServiceImpl) Delete(c context.Context, id rbac.UserID) error

Delete ...

func (*UserServiceImpl) Find

func (inst *UserServiceImpl) Find(c context.Context, id rbac.UserID) (*rbac.UserDTO, error)

Find ...

func (*UserServiceImpl) Insert

func (inst *UserServiceImpl) Insert(c context.Context, o *rbac.UserDTO) (*rbac.UserDTO, error)

Insert ...

func (*UserServiceImpl) List

func (inst *UserServiceImpl) List(c context.Context, q *rbac.UserQuery) ([]*rbac.UserDTO, error)

List ...

func (*UserServiceImpl) Update

func (inst *UserServiceImpl) Update(c context.Context, id rbac.UserID, o *rbac.UserDTO) (*rbac.UserDTO, error)

Update ...

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L